Chicago Bar Foundation Chair Explains Importance of Pro Bono Amid COVID-19 Challenges

Pro bono and legal aid organizations around the country face a perfect storm: The need for their services is skyrocketing at the same time that law firms, a critical funding source for much of pro bono and legal aid, are under severe stress.

We know that the demand for pro bono and legal aid services is rising — and we can predict that this demand is likely to grow to unprecedented levels. After the Great Recession of 2007-2008, the number of people eligible for legal aid rose by more than 22%, to over 61 million nationally.

We need our law firms across the country to step up now, as they have done in the past, to help fill the gap between the dwindling supply and growing demand. We have done so in the past — and we can do so now.
